ASUS ROG GL503GE-EN034T RAM upgrade specifications
ASUS ROG Strix GL503GE-EN034T laptop memory upgrade specifications include DDR4-SDRAM compatible RAM modules. The system features 2x SO-DIMM slots with maximum capacity of 32 GB total memory. Compatible upgrades utilize SO-DIMM form factor operating at 2666 MHz frequency. Specifications support DDR4-SDRAM technology for enhanced performance and multitasking capabilities.
Memory Upgrade Specifications
| Specification | Value |
|---|---|
| Memory slots | 2x SO-DIMM |
| Form factor | SO-DIMM |
| Memory type | DDR4-SDRAM |
| Frequency | 2666 MHz |
| Maximum RAM | 32 GB |
| Voltage | 1.2V |
| Number of pins | 260-pin |
| Interface | PC4 |
| PC Speed Rating | PC4-2666 (PC4-21328) |
| Bandwidth | 21.3 GB/s |
| Laptop Release date | 16 March 2018 |
